SIDE WINDOW GLASS
Removal and InstallationINFOID:0000000003533063
REMOVAL
1. Remove the rear lower and upper finisher. Refer to EI-34.
2. Disconnect the rear side window motor harness.
3. Remove the rear side window motor mounting bolts.
4. Remove the rear side window front mounting nuts.
INSTALLATION
1. Install the glass from outside to insure that it is even with the top and bottom of the opening. Tighten rear
side window front mounting nuts to the specified torque.
2. Install rear side window motor mounting bolts. Tighten rear side window latch mounting bolts to the speci-
fied torque.
3. Connect the rear side window motor harness.
4. Install rear pillar upper and lower finisher. Refer to EI-34
.
1. Rear side window glass 2. Rear side window motor 3. Weatherstrip
4. Inner panel 5. Outer panel
LIIA0965E
Glass mounting nuts : 4.2 N·m (0.43 kg-m, 37 in-lb)
Motor mounting bolts : 5.6 N·m (0.57 kg-m, 49 in-lb)

System DescriptionINFOID:0000000003533067
The rear window defogger system is controlled by BCM (body control module) and IPDM E/R (intelligent
power distribution module engine room).
The rear window defogger operates only for approximately 15 minutes.
Power is supplied at all times
• through 15A fuses (No. 43, 46, and 47 located in the IPDM E/R)
• to rear window defogger relay and heated mirror relay (located in the IPDM E/R)
• through 50A fusible link (letter f, located in the fuse and fusible link box)
• to BCM terminal 70.
With the ignition switch turned to ON or START position, power is supplied
• through ignition switch
• to rear window defogger relay (located in the IPDM E/R)
• through 10A fuse (No. 59, located in the fuse and relay box)
• to BCM terminal 38
• through 10A fuse [No. 8, located in the fuse block (J/B)]
• to front air control terminal 14.
Ground is supplied
• to BCM terminal 67
• to front air control terminal 1
• through body grounds M57, M61 and M79

• to IPDM E/R terminals 38 and 59
• through body grounds E9, E15 and E24.
When front air control (rear window defogger switch) is turned to ON, ground is supplied
• to BCM terminal 9
• through front air control terminal 11
• through front air control terminal 1
• through body grounds M57, M61 and M79.
Then rear window defogger switch is illuminated.
Then BCM recognizes that rear window defogger switch is turned to ON.
Then it sends rear window defogger switch signals to IPDM E/R and display control unit via CAN communica-
tion (CAN-H, CAN-L).
When display control unit receives rear window defogger switch signals, and displays on the screen.
When IPDM E/R receives rear window defogger switch signals, ground is supplied
• to rear window defogger relay (located in the IPDM E/R)
• through IPDM E/R terminal 38
• through IPDM E/R terminal 59
• through body grounds E9, E15 and E24
and then rear window defogger relay is energized.
With power and ground supplied, rear window defogger filaments heat and defog the rear window.
When rear window defogger relay is turned to ON, power is supplied
• through heated mirror relay (located in the IPDM E/R)
• through IPDM E/R terminal 23
• to door mirror defogger (LH and RH) terminal 10.
Door mirror defogger (LH and RH) is grounded through body grounds M57, M61 and M79.
With power and ground supplied, rear window defogger filaments heat and defog the rear window and door
mirror defogger filaments heat and defog the mirror.

CONSULT-II Function (BCM)INFOID:0000000003533074
CONSULT-II can display each diagnostic item using the diagnostic test modes shown following.
CONSULT-II START PROCEDURE
Refer to GI-36, "CONSULT-II Start Procedure".
DATA MONITOR
Display Item List
ACTIVE TEST
Display Item List
Trouble Diagnosis Symptom ChartINFOID:0000000003533075
Make sure other systems using the signal of the following systems operate normally.
BCM diagnostic
test itemDiagnostic mode Content
Inspection by partWORK SUPPORTSupports inspections and adjustments. Commands are transmitted to the BCM for
setting the status suitable for required operation, input/output signals are received
from the BCM and received data is displayed.
DATA MONITOR Displays BCM input/output data in real time.
ACTIVE TEST Operation of electrical loads can be checked by sending drive signal to them.
SELF-DIAG RESULTS Displays BCM self-diagnosis results.
CAN DIAG SUPPORT MNTR The results of transmit/receive diagnosis of CAN communication can be read.
ECU PART NUMBER BCM part number can be read.
CONFIGURATION Performs BCM configuration read/write functions.
Monitor item “Operation” Content
REAR DEF SW “ON/OFF”Displays “Press (ON)/others (OFF)” status determined with the rear window defogger
switch.
IGN ON SW “ON/OFF” Displays “IGN (ON)/OFF” status determined with the ignition switch signal.
Test item Content
REAR WINDOW DEFOGGER Gives a drive signal to the rear window defogger to activate it.
